| package sensor
 | |
| 
 | |
| import (
 | |
| 	"context"
 | |
| 	"fmt"
 | |
| 	"sync"
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	"github.com/go-flucky/flucky/pkg/internal/format"
 | |
| 	"github.com/go-flucky/flucky/pkg/types"
 | |
| 	"github.com/go-flucky/go-dht"
 | |
| 	uuid "github.com/satori/go.uuid"
 | |
| )
 | |
| 
 | |
| // DHT22 is a sensor to measure humidity and temperature.
 | |
| type DHT22 struct {
 | |
| 	*types.Sensor
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| // GetSensorModel returns the sensor model
 | |
| func (s *DHT22) GetSensorModel() types.SensorModel {
 | |
| 	return s.Sensor.SensorModel
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| // Read measured values
 | |
| func (s *DHT22) Read() ([]*types.MeasuredValue, error) {
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	err := dht.HostInit()
 | |
| 	if err != nil {
 | |
| 		return nil, fmt.Errorf("HostInit error: %v", err)
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	gpio, err := types.GPIOToString(*s.GPIONumber)
 | |
| 	if err != nil {
 | |
| 		return nil, err
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	dht, err := dht.NewDHT(gpio, dht.Celsius, "")
 | |
| 	if err != nil {
 | |
| 		return nil, fmt.Errorf("NewDHT error: %v", err)
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	humidityValue, temperatureValue, err := dht.Read()
 | |
| 	if err != nil {
 | |
| 		return nil, fmt.Errorf("Read error: %v", err)
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	measuredValues := []*types.MeasuredValue{
 | |
| 		&types.MeasuredValue{
 | |
| 			ID:        uuid.NewV4().String(),
 | |
| 			Value:     float64(humidityValue),
 | |
| 			ValueType: types.MeasuredValueTypeHumidity,
 | |
| 			FromDate:  format.FormatedTime(),
 | |
| 			TillDate:  format.FormatedTime(),
 | |
| 			SensorID:  s.SensorID,
 | |
| 		},
 | |
| 		&types.MeasuredValue{
 | |
| 			ID:        uuid.NewV4().String(),
 | |
| 			Value:     float64(temperatureValue),
 | |
| 			ValueType: types.MeasuredValueTypeTemperature,
 | |
| 			FromDate:  format.FormatedTime(),
 | |
| 			TillDate:  format.FormatedTime(),
 | |
| 			SensorID:  s.SensorID,
 | |
| 		},
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return measuredValues, nil
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| // ReadChannel reads the measured values from the sensor and writes them to a
 | |
| // channel.
 | |
| func (s *DHT22) ReadChannel(measuredValueChannel chan<- *types.MeasuredValue, errorChannel chan<- error, wg *sync.WaitGroup) {
 | |
| 	if wg != nil {
 | |
| 		defer wg.Done()
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	measuredValues, err := s.Read()
 | |
| 	if err != nil {
 | |
| 		errorChannel <- err
 | |
| 		return
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for _, measuredValue := range measuredValues {
 | |
| 		measuredValueChannel <- measuredValue
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| // ReadContinously reads the measured values continously from the sensor and
 | |
| // writes them to a channel.
 | |
| func (s *DHT22) ReadContinously(ctx context.Context, measuredValueChannel chan<- *types.MeasuredValue, errorChannel chan<- error) {
 | |
| 	for {
 | |
| 		select {
 | |
| 		case <-ctx.Done():
 | |
| 			errorChannel <- fmt.Errorf("%v: Context closed: %v", s.SensorName, ctx.Err())
 | |
| 			return
 | |
| 		default:
 | |
| 			s.ReadChannel(measuredValueChannel, errorChannel, nil)
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
